We are seeking an experienced Senior Programme Manager to lead a large-scale Electronic Patient Record (EPR) transformation programme within a leading private healthcare organisation. This is a strategic leadership role responsible for overseeing the end-to-end delivery of a complex digital transformation initiative, ensuring the successful implementation and adoption of an enterprise-wide EPR platform. The successful candidate will work closely with executive stakeholders, clinical leaders, operational teams, and technology partners to deliver meaningful improvements in patient care, operational efficiency, and data-driven decision making. While experience with Epic is highly desirable, we welcome applications from candidates who have successfully delivered programmes involving other major EPR platforms such as Cerner/Oracle Health, MEDITECH, Allscripts, Nervecentre, Lorenzo, EMIS, RiO, or similar healthcare information systems.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ead the delivery of a multi-workstream EPR transformation programme from planning through to implementation and benefits realisation.
  • Develop and maintain programme governance, reporting, risk management, and stakeholder engagement frameworks.
  • Manage programme budgets, resource plans, timelines, dependencies, and third-party suppliers.
  • Work closely with clinical, operational, and executive stakeholders to ensure alignment with organisational objectives.
  • Drive organisational readiness, change management, and user adoption strategies across the business.
  • Ensure programme delivery adheres to regulatory, governance, and information security requirements.
  • Oversee programme and project managers responsible for individual workstreams including clinical systems, infrastructure, integration, training, testing, and deployment.
  • Manage vendor relationships and hold implementation partners accountable for delivery outcomes.
  • Provide regular programme updates to executive leadership, steering committees, and board-level stakeholders.
  • Establish and track programme KPIs, benefits realisation metrics, and post-implementation performance measures.
  • Foster a culture of collaboration, continuous improvement, and patient-centred innovation.

Essential Experience

  • Significant experience leading large-scale healthcare digital transformation programmes.
  • Proven track record delivering EPR/EHR implementations within acute, community, private healthcare, or wider healthcare environments.
  • Experience managing complex programmes involving multiple stakeholders, suppliers, and workstreams.
  • Strong understanding of programme governance methodologies including MSP, PRINCE2, Agile, or equivalent frameworks.
  • Demonstrable experience managing substantial programme budgets and senior stakeholder relationships.
  • Exceptional leadership, communication, negotiation, and influencing skills.
  • Experience driving organisational change and user adoption within clinically focused environments.

Desirable Experience

  • Direct experience delivering Epic implementations or optimisation programmes.
  • Experience with other major EPR platforms including Oracle Health (Cerner), MEDITECH, Nervecentre, Allscripts, Lorenzo, EMIS, RiO, or equivalent systems.
  • Knowledge of healthcare interoperability standards and system integrations.
  • Experience working within private healthcare settings.
  • Relevant programme management qualifications (MSP, PRINCE2 Practitioner, Agile certifications, PMP, or equivalent).
